Go语言在区块链项目开发中的应用及技巧
Go语言简介
Go语言,又称Golang,是由Google开发的一种静态类型、编译型、并发型,并具有垃圾回收功能的编程语言。由于其高效性能和便于编写的特点,Go语言在区块链项目的开发中备受青睐。
Go语言在区块链项目中的优势
在区块链项目中,高效的性能和并发编程是至关重要的。而
此外,Go语言还拥有丰富的标准库和强大的工具链,为区块链项目带来了更多便利。它支持CSP(Communicating Sequential Processes)并发模型,有利于处理区块链网络中复杂的通信和同步问题。
Go语言开发区块链项目的技巧
在使用
另外,在处理区块链的加密算法时,Go语言提供了丰富的加密库,开发者可以充分利用这些库来保障区块链数据的安全性。此外,Go语言还支持与C/C++的混合编程,当需要对性能要求极高的部分进行优化时,可以借助Go语言的这一特性。
结语
在区块链项目的开发中,选择合适的编程语言可以极大地影响开发效率和最终的项目性能。Go语言凭借其并发特性、高效性能、丰富的标准库和工具链,以及严谨的类型系统,成为了众多开发者在区块链领域的首选。熟练掌握
感谢您阅读完这篇文章,希望这些关于Go语言在区块链项目开发中的应用及技巧能对您有所帮助。